We welcome back Elina and Rob to Stamford following last year’s magical concert, which was our first one in the lovely Methodist Church.
This concert follows the release of their new album, A Time To Remember ECM Records.
As the title suggests, the notion of ‘time’ pulls through the programme like a theme, connecting music from different parts of the world – traditionals, popular songs and original compositions – in performances of deep lyricism but also fleet-footed folklore. The repertory spans Albanian and Kosovan traditionals, American songs as well as originals by Rob and Elina.
Jazzwise said that “the sum of Duni and Luft’s work together seems greater than their individual achievements, where concept and conceptualisation have combined to produce a classic. In this occasion they are backed up by one of the finest rythmn sections in the UK: Tom McCredie on bass and Corrie Dick on drums.
